资源管理站

小学数学练习出题器 V3.0 —— 一款功能完整的 Excel VBA 出题工具

zyglz 62 0

特别声明:本文为原创,可自由转载、引用,但需署名作者且注明文章出处,如有侵权请联系!

一、工具简介

这是一款基于 Excel VBA 开发的小学数学练习出题器,专门为小学生设计,可以帮助老师或家长快速生成各类数学练习题。

核心特点

  • ✅ 完全免费,只需 Excel 即可运行
  • ✅ 参数高度可调,满足不同年级需求
  • ✅ 支持两数运算 + 多步混合运算
  • ✅ 排版灵活,可直接打印使用

二、功能模块介绍

2.1 通用设置

参数说明推荐值
题目数量一次生成多少道题20~50
每行题数一行显示几道题2~3
列宽每列的宽度(磅)35
题目行高题目所在行的高度30
空白行高竖式区空白行的高度40
显示题号每题前是否显示序号
留竖式空白区域是否留出手写竖式的空白行
显示边框是否显示表格虚线边框

2.2 加法设置

参数说明
启用加法是否生成加法题
加数1范围第一个加数的取值范围
加数2范围第二个加数的取值范围
和的最大值计算结果的上限
允许进位个位相加是否允许 ≥10
随机交换加数随机显示 a+b 或 b+a

2.3 减法设置

参数说明
启用减法是否生成减法题
被减数范围被减数的取值范围
减数范围减数的取值范围
差的最小值结果必须 ≥ 此值
允许退位个位相减是否允许借位
允许负数结果是否允许被减数小于减数

2.4 乘法设置

参数说明
启用乘法是否生成乘法题
乘数1范围第一个乘数的取值范围
乘数2范围第二个乘数的取值范围
积的最大值乘积的上限
随机交换乘数随机显示 a×b 或 b×a

2.5 除法设置

参数说明
启用除法是否生成除法题
被除数范围被除数的取值范围
除数范围除数的取值范围(自动排除0)
要求整除不允许有余数

有余数时的记法17 ÷ 5 = 3 ...... 2

2.6 混合运算设置(独立)

参数说明
启用混合运算启用后忽略上方运算选择
数字范围参与运算的数字范围
允许的运算加法/减法/乘法/除法(可多选)
运算步数几个数字参与(2~6)
最终结果范围结果必须在此范围内
结果必须为整数除法时要求整除
中间结果非负每一步结果都 ≥0
运算顺序从左到右 / 先乘除后加减

三、界面预览

控制面板按功能分为以下区域:

小学数学练习题.jpg


四、练习题输出效果

4.1 勾选“留竖式空白区域”时

每道题下方留出一行空白,供学生手写竖式:

数学练习题生成程序-100内加减法1.jpg

4.2 不勾选时

每道题只占一行,紧凑排列,适合快速口算练习。

数学练习题生成程序-连加连减.jpg

4.3 边框显示效果

勾选“显示边框”时,题目区域会有虚线边框,便于学生定位答题位置。


五、使用步骤

第一步:设置参数

  • 根据学生年级和练习需求,调整各区域参数
  • 混合运算需要单独勾选启用

第二步:生成题目

  • 点击 生成题目 按钮
  • 题目自动生成到“练习题”工作表中

第三步:打印或使用

  • 可直接在 Excel 中练习
  • 点击 打印预览 调整后打印

第四步:清空重置

  • 点击 清空练习区 可清除当前题目,重新生成

六、分年级推荐配置

年级推荐设置
一年级加法、减法(不进位/不退位),数字范围 0~20,和≤20,不留竖式区
二年级加法(进位)、减法(退位)、表内乘法,数字范围 0~100
三年级加减乘除混合(从左到右),数字范围 0~100,可留竖式区
四年级以上多步混合运算(先乘除后加减),步数 3~4,含除法有余数

七、技术亮点

功能说明
两位数加法限制可单独设置“和的最大值”,加数自动保持在 10~99
有余数除法显示为 17 ÷ 5 = 3 ...... 2 格式,符合小学规范
允许负数减法可设置是否允许被减数小于减数
运算优先级同时支持“从左到右”和“先乘除后加减”两种模式
排版灵活可独立设置题目行高和空白行高,适应书写需求
边框控制可选择是否显示虚线边框,打印时更清晰

八、总结

这款小学数学练习出题器有以下优势:

  1. 完全免费:只要有 Excel 就能运行
  2. 高度定制:每个运算都有独立参数,适应不同学习阶段
  3. 题型丰富:支持加减乘除 + 混合运算,覆盖小学全部计算类型
  4. 排版专业:可留竖式区、可调行高、可打印,直接用于课堂练习
  5. 操作简单:控制面板一目了然,设置后一键生成

无论是老师备课、家长辅导,还是孩子的日常练习,这个工具都能大大节省出题时间,让练习更有针对性。


技术福利

如果需要获取==完整文件==的,可以关注公众号获取:

关注微信公众号获取

公众号:资源管理站 扫码关注 · 获取更多资源
微信搜一搜:资源管理站
后台回复关键词:246
自动获取:专属资源文件

交流互动

如果任何其他问题,欢迎在公众号留言交流。

小贴士:如果本文对你有帮助,欢迎分享给更多需要的朋友!你的支持是我持续创作的动力。

公众号

上一篇Excel VBA 常用 RGB 颜色参考表

下一篇没有了

评论列表 (已有0条评论)

消灭零回复

发表评论 (已有0条评论)

icon_lol.gif2016zhh.gif2016fendou.gif2016lengh.gificon_exclaim.gif2016gg.gif2016yhh.gificon_cry.gif2016bs.gif2016qd.gif2016bz.gificon_eek.gif2016ka.gif2016zhem.gificon_confused.gif2016qq.gif2016db.gif2016jk.gif2016tuu.gif2016zk.gif2016kk.gificon_neutral.gif